The greatest unresolved mystery in the history of our world is GOD. Little Book Of God: Merging Science With God resolves this mystery, using concepts so uniquely bold, provocative, and original that the reader can’t help but feel he or she has been gently tapped over the head with a sledgehammer.

I poke away at our human brain and Divine soul intelligence by not so subtly attempting to empower you to accept the inevitable conclusions for the evidence for God. God is the Master Scientist and we, the human race, are God’s experiment. Within the pages of Little Book of God: Merging Science with God, God’s untold story emerges. God is the big bang. God is the universe. God is space itself and is the unseen energy field that brings life to elementary particles which in turn bring life to all evolutionary species. God is the Chi, the life force of all existence.

God is Energy. In Little Book of God: Merging Science with God, our Creator is portrayed as limitless forms of ever expanding Energy that are trillions to quadrillions of times greater than any one human being. God is depicted as timeless, the Ancient One, all knowing and all powerful. God did not simply create our universe at a prehistoric time when only He existed. God represents an organizing intelligence that is responsible for the being of us all. He preplanned the entirety of our world in advance. Only He didn’t tell us, so that human beings would have the thrill of making their own new discoveries. God gave each of us Divine soul Energy which like oxygen is essential to life. He calculated in a fail-safe future world where we shall live forever in harmony with our fellow spiritual human beings and with nature and where time and timelessness impossibly exist together.
